    Quote Originally Posted by Valda View Post
    Heh, so хватит канючить is closer to "quit bitchin'" ?
    No
    канючить comes from a word канюк - Common Buzzard -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ia . That bird has particularly annoying call So хватит канючить is more like stop pester me.
    quit bitchin' would be хватить ныть or хватит ворчать.
